On 24 November the sculptural group “Brother Gabriel on the way out” was inaugurated in Ambato (Ecuador) at the “Sagrada Familia” Educational Unit in Ambato. It was the closing of the 200th anniversary of the departure of Brother Gabriel and the celebration of the 15th anniversary of the Holy Family Educational Unit of Ambato.

Approximately 80 members of the Sa-fa Family in Brazil, including 70 young people and around 10 educators, gathered in the city of Marau, in the north of Rio Grande do Sul, for the Youth Mission. The event took place between 25 and 27 October.
